Distance and Flight Duration
The distance between Miami International Airport (MIA) and Buenos Aires’ Ministro Pistarini International Airport (commonly known as Ezeiza Airport) is approximately 4,406 miles (7,090 kilometers) or 3,828 nautical miles. This translates to a direct flight duration of about 8 hours and 50 minutes, making it a long-haul but manageable journey across the Americas.
Airports in Buenos Aires
Buenos Aires is served by two main international airports:
- Ministro Pistarini International Airport (Ezeiza Airport): This is the primary international gateway for Buenos Aires, located about 22 kilometers (13.7 miles) from the city center. It is the larger of the two airports and handles most of the long-haul international flights, including those from Miami.
- Jorge Newbery International Airport (Aeroparque): Located much closer to the city center, just 7 kilometers (4.3 miles) away, Aeroparque primarily handles domestic flights and some regional international flights within South America. While it’s not the airport you’ll arrive at from Miami, it’s important to know if you have connecting flights within Argentina or to nearby countries.
Timezone Difference
Buenos Aires operates on Argentina Standard Time (ART), which is 1 hour ahead of Miami, Florida. This minor timezone difference means that adjusting to the local time in Buenos Aires should be relatively easy, with minimal to not any jet lag expected.
